September 30, 2024
The sectional pairings for the 58th Annual IHSAA Boys Tennis State Tournament were revealed to an online audience via IHSAAtv.org this evening.
A total of 292 schools were drawn and placed into brackets for the team tournament which begins Tuesday (Oct. 1) and runs through Saturday (Oct. 5).
The 64 team sectional winners will advance to regional play Oct. 8 and 9 at 16 sites. The regional champions will advance to semi-state play Oct. 12 at Center Grove, Culver Academies, Homestead, and Jasper. The eight-team state finals are scheduled for Oct. 18 and 19 with all matches – quarterfinals, semifinals and statechampionship – being played at North Central High School in Indianapolis.
The Brebeuf Jesuit Braves, the top-ranked team in this week’s poll from the Indiana High School Tennis Coaches Association (IHSTeCA), will meet Pike in the semifinals of Sectional 36.
The defending state champion and third-ranked Carmel Greyhounds will host No. 12 Guerin Catholic in a Sectional 35 first round match.

About the Draw
To conduct the random drawing for the state tournament, the IHSAA places ping-pong balls representing each school in each sectional into a lottery-style air mix machine. A motorized fan in the bottom of the machine blows the balls around the inside of the transparent container and air then forces each ball up through a tube in random order. For example, the first ball retrieved from the machine will be the first placement in the first match with the second ball representing their opponent in that match. The third ball to come out is the third placement in the second match with the fourth ball their opponent in the second match.
That same method is followed through all sectionals, regionals and semi-states to determine every team’s
placement in the bracket.

Most Consecutive Sectional Championships
43 by Munster (1981-current).
